TransTechnology Reports $27 Million in Contracts

TransTechnology Corp., a Sherman Oaks manufacturer of products for the aerospace and defense industries, said it was awarded new contracts totaling $27 million in the first five weeks of this year.
The contracts included a $6.4-million award from the U.S. Defense Department for chaff, clouds of metalized glass fibers that aircraft and ships discharge as defensive decoys to draw radar-tracked weapons away from their intended targets.
TransTechnology said it also won a $5.8-million contract from an unidentified West German company to make hoists and control assemblies. Those products will be used by the North Atlantic Treaty Organization on multiple-launch rocket systems being built in Europe.
